Auto Areas: An extensive Overview
Automobile components are classified into various important units that function collectively to ensure The sleek operation of a automobile.

Motor Components:

Pistons: Change gasoline into mechanical Electricity.
Crankshaft: Converts the linear motion of pistons into rotational motion.
Valves: Regulate the move of air and gasoline in the engine and exhaust from it.
Camshaft: Controls the opening and closing of valves.
Transmission Pieces:

Clutch: Engages and disengages the power through the engine towards the transmission.
Gearbox: Provides distinct equipment ratios to control the automobile's velocity and torque.
Differential: Enables the wheels to rotate at diverse speeds though turning.
Suspension and Steering Components:

Shock Absorbers: Soak up and dampen shock impulses.
Struts: Support the automobile's weight and take in shocks.
Steering Rack: Converts the steering wheel's rotational motion into linear movement to show the wheels.
Braking Procedure:

Brake Pads: Create friction towards the brake discs to slow down the auto.
Brake Discs/Rotors: Supply a floor for that brake pads to Get in touch with.
Brake Calipers: Residence the brake pads and pistons that press them in opposition to the discs.
Electrical and Digital Areas:

Battery: Provides electrical power to start the engine and electrical power electrical parts.
Alternator: Prices the battery and powers the electrical procedure when the engine is working.
ECU (Engine Regulate Device): Manages motor functionality and performance.
System and Inside Sections:

Overall body Panels: Sort the outside shell on the motor vehicle.
Seats: Present consolation and safety for occupants.
Dashboard: Homes the instrument panel and controls.
Car Elements Manufacturing
Manufacturing auto sections will involve various procedures, which include casting, forging, machining, and assembly. The field depends on precision engineering and Superior technologies to supply high-high quality factors.

Casting and Forging:

Casting: Molten steel is poured into molds to produce parts like motor blocks and cylinder heads.
Forging: Steel is shaped utilizing compressive forces to supply strong and durable factors which include crankshafts and connecting rods.
Machining:

CNC Machining: Laptop or computer-controlled machines exactly Reduce and form parts.
Grinding and Drilling: Complete and high-quality-tune components for specific requirements.
Assembly:

Automated Assembly Traces: Robots automobile parts and equipment assemble elements rapidly and successfully.
Manual Assembly: Skilled staff assemble extra advanced parts and techniques.
High-quality Manage:

Inspection and Screening: Parts are inspected and tested to guarantee they meet stringent excellent standards.
Certification: Sections are certified to comply with industry rules and standards.
Car Traction Pieces
Traction elements are essential for giving the necessary grip and balance on the motor vehicle, particularly in challenging driving problems.

Different types of Traction Components:

Tires: Supply grip and traction on a variety of surfaces.
Travel Shafts: Transfer energy in the transmission towards the wheels.
Axles: Help the load in the motor vehicle and transfer ability to your wheels.
Worth of Traction:

Basic safety: Superior traction lessens the potential risk of skidding and incidents.
General performance: Boosts the auto's managing and acceleration.
Effectiveness: Increases gas effectiveness by decreasing wheel slippage.
Traction Systems:

All-Wheel Push (AWD): Distributes electrical power to all four wheels for improved traction.
Traction Command Programs (TCS): Instantly reduces motor energy or applies brakes to circumvent wheel slip.
Constrained-Slip Differentials (LSD): Gives far better traction by distributing energy to the wheels with probably the most grip.
